Property Amenities
Located on 16 waterfront acres on San Diego Bay, the Marriott Coronado Island Resort provides scheduled water-taxi service to a partner hotel across the bay, within six blocks of the San Diego Convention Center, PETCO Park, and the Gaslamp Quarter.
On-site recreation options include a health spa (surcharge), fitness center with sauna and exercise classes, tennis courts, and three outdoor pools with poolside fire pits.
With outdoor seating and bay views, Current serves California coastal cuisine; Tides is a coffee bar by day and cocktail lounge by night. Apoolside bar is open seasonally, and room service is available 24 hours.
The resort has 14,000 square feet of meeting and event space, including 15 meeting and conference rooms, and a ballroom for 800 guests. A business center provides high-speed Internet access, printing, faxing, and copying (surcharges). Wireless Internet access is available in the lobby and other public areas (surcharge).
Room Amenities
Rooms
The Marriott Coronado Island Resort offers 300 guestrooms in multiple three-story buildings. All rooms have private, furnished balconies or patios with views of the bay or resort grounds.
Amenities include high-speed Internet access (surcharge), complimentary newspapers, in-room safes, and premium channels. Rooms also connect laptops, MP3, cameras, and video games to a flat screen TV. Clock radios offer MP3 connections. Large bathrooms have separate showers and soaking tubs.
Upon check-in, guests can request Marriott's Wired for Business service, with high-speed Internet access and unlimited local and domestic long-distance calls for a daily fee.

Dining
Current - Healthy California coastal cuisine in a relaxed, contemporary environment, with bay views and outdoor terrace dining. Breakfast, lunch, and dinner daily.
Tides - Coffee bar by day, cocktail lounge at night. Sleek, modern setting. Lunch and dinner daily; lounge open until late night.
Pool Bar - Adjacent to the main pool. Open from late morning until early evening, Memorial Day until Labor Day.
Room services is available 24 hours daily.
Recreation
Guests choose from three outdoor pools: the main freeform pool, a lap pool adjacent to the health spa, and a splash pool at the villa building. Two spa tubs are also on site.
In addition to offering massage and other treatments (surcharge), the health spa includes a complimentary fitness center with free weights, treadmills with individual LCD TVs, and a sauna. Complimentary scheduled Pilates, yoga, and aerobics classes are available. Guests must be at least 18 years old to use the spa and fitness facilities.
Additional options include six tennis courts, basketball, seasonal water-sports equipment rentals, and year-round bicycle rentals.
A block away, Tidelands Park has a small beach and a playground. Coronado Beach, one mile away, offers a wide, sandy beach and numerous water sports. Also a mile away, the Coronado Golf Course has an 18-hole, par 72 course, pro shop, and driving range. Squash is within one mile.

“Hotel is decent”
Pools are open early and late and heated to a pretty decent temperature. Largest pool usually has tons of children splashing around so if you aren't into that, plan on going early or late for a swim.The other pools are not in the central part of the hotel, but they are available. Hotel food is ok, not ground shattering. Hotel is clean and staff is friendly. Island is small enough that you can just get out right at the water's edge to walk around. You can drive pretty quickly (depending on traffic) to the other side of the island where a lot more activity goes on, ie along Orange, etc... The hotel is situated facing the bay, though, so if you want to see only beach and Pacific Ocean, this isn't the hotel for you. There is free street parking available near the hotel if you want to save a few bucks.

Coronado, California, United States of America: Coronado, attached to the mainland by the San Diego-Coronado Bridge, is a wealthy island community west of downtown San Diego. Visitors flock to the picturesque beachfront city to soak up the sunshine at Coronado's many top-rated beaches. Coronado is crowned by the elegant Hotel del Coronado, a beachfront Victorian resort completed in 1887 and now a designated National Historic Landmark.
